Payroll Taxes in New Mexico

Federal Payroll Taxes

Federal earnings tax: Employers should withhold federal earnings tax from staff’ wages. The quantity is dependent upon the worker’s W-4 type and the IRS tax tables. This tax funds numerous federal packages and providers.

Social Safety tax: Each employers and staff contribute to Social Safety. The present price is 6.2% every, utilized to wages as much as a sure restrict. This tax helps retirement, incapacity, and survivor advantages.

Medicare tax: Employers and staff additionally share the price of Medicare. The speed is 1.45% every, with no wage restrict. Excessive earners pay an extra 0.9% on wages above a sure threshold.

Federal Unemployment Tax (FUTA): Employers pay FUTA to fund unemployment advantages. The speed is 6% on the primary $7,000 of every worker’s wages. Employers might obtain a credit score of as much as 5.4% for state unemployment taxes paid, lowering the efficient price to 0.6%.

New Mexico State Payroll Taxes

State earnings tax: Employers should withhold state earnings tax from staff’ wages. The quantity is dependent upon the worker’s New Mexico withholding type and the state tax tables. This tax helps state packages and providers.

State Unemployment Tax (SUTA): Employers pay SUTA to fund state unemployment advantages. New Mexico’s charges range primarily based on the employer’s business and expertise ranking. New employers sometimes begin with an ordinary price, which can change over time.

Employees’ compensation insurance coverage: New Mexico requires employers to offer employees’ compensation insurance coverage. This insurance coverage covers medical bills and misplaced wages for workers injured on the job. Charges rely on the employer’s business and claims historical past.

Incapacity insurance coverage: Whereas not obligatory in New Mexico, some employers provide incapacity insurance coverage as a profit. This insurance coverage gives earnings alternative for workers unable to work as a result of sickness or damage. Employers can select to cowl the associated fee or share it with staff.

Payroll types and filings in New Mexico

Dealing with payroll in New Mexico includes a number of types and filings to make sure compliance with federal and state laws. Every type serves a particular objective and have to be submitted precisely and on time.

Kind W-4 for federal earnings tax withholding: Workers full Kind W-4 to find out the quantity of federal earnings tax to withhold from their paychecks. This manner consists of details about submitting standing, variety of dependents, and extra withholding quantities. Employers use this information to calculate the right withholding quantity primarily based on IRS tips.

Kind RPD-41071 for state earnings tax withholding: Much like the federal W-4, Kind RPD-41071 is used for New Mexico state earnings tax withholding. Workers present their private info and withholding preferences. Employers then use this info to withhold the suitable quantity of state earnings tax from every paycheck, guaranteeing compliance with New Mexico tax legal guidelines.

Kind ES903A for state unemployment insurance coverage: Employers should file Kind ES903A to report wages and pay state unemployment insurance coverage (SUTA) taxes. This manner is submitted quarterly and consists of particulars on worker wages and the calculated unemployment tax due. Correct and well timed submission of this way helps preserve compliance with state unemployment insurance coverage necessities.

Kind WC-1 for employees’ compensation insurance coverage: Employers in New Mexico are required to offer employees’ compensation insurance coverage. Kind WC-1 is used to report and pay employees’ compensation premiums. This manner ensures that employers are contributing to the employees’ compensation fund, which gives advantages to staff injured on the job. Submitting this way precisely helps keep away from penalties and ensures protection for workers.

Quarterly wage studies and annual reconciliation: Employers should submit quarterly wage studies to each federal and state companies. These studies element worker wages, taxes withheld, and different payroll-related info. Moreover, an annual reconciliation is required to make sure that all quarterly filings match the full annual payroll information. This course of includes reviewing and correcting any discrepancies to take care of correct data and compliance.

arrange payroll in New Mexico

Establishing payroll in New Mexico includes a number of steps to make sure compliance with federal and state laws. Right here’s an in depth information that can assist you navigate the method.

First, you must acquire a Federal Employer Identification Quantity (FEIN) from the IRS. This distinctive quantity identifies your online business for tax functions. You may apply for a FEIN on-line by way of the IRS web site. This quantity is important for reporting taxes and different paperwork to the IRS.

Subsequent, register your online business with the New Mexico Taxation and Income Division. This registration means that you can withhold state earnings taxes out of your staff’ wages and remit them to the state. You may full this registration on-line by way of the New Mexico Taxpayer Entry Level (TAP). This step ensures you adjust to state tax legal guidelines and laws.

Then, Get hold of employees’ compensation insurance coverage. New Mexico requires employers to offer employees’ compensation insurance coverage. This insurance coverage covers medical bills and misplaced wages for workers who get injured on the job. You may acquire employees’ compensation insurance coverage by way of a non-public insurance coverage service or the New Mexico Employees’ Compensation Administration. Be sure that to maintain your coverage updated and preserve data of your protection.

Arrange a payroll system or rent a payroll service supplier: Determine whether or not to handle payroll in-house or rent a payroll service supplier. When you select to deal with payroll your self, put money into dependable payroll software program that may calculate wages, withhold taxes, and generate paychecks. Make sure the software program is up to date repeatedly to adjust to tax legal guidelines. Alternatively, you possibly can rent a payroll service supplier to deal with these duties for you. This selection can save time and cut back the danger of errors.

Gather worker info and tax types: Collect all mandatory info and tax types out of your staff. This consists of Kind W-4 for federal earnings tax withholding and Kind RPD-41071 for New Mexico state earnings tax withholding. Guarantee you may have correct data of every worker’s Social Safety quantity, deal with, and different related particulars. Correct documentation helps you calculate and withhold the right amount of taxes.

What are the penalties for payroll non-compliance in New Mexico?

Failing to adjust to payroll laws in New Mexico can result in a number of penalties and authorized penalties. Understanding these penalties may help you keep away from expensive errors and guarantee your payroll processes are correct and well timed.

Failure to pay payroll taxes can lead to curiosity and penalties. When you don’t pay federal or state payroll taxes on time, you could incur curiosity prices on the unpaid quantity. Moreover, penalties will be imposed for late funds, which might accumulate rapidly and considerably enhance your tax legal responsibility.

Non-compliance with minimal wage and additional time legal guidelines can result in fines and authorized motion. New Mexico has particular minimal wage and additional time necessities that employers should comply with. When you pay staff lower than the mandated minimal wage or fail to pay additional time for hours labored past the usual workweek, you might face fines. Workers might also file lawsuits for unpaid wages, resulting in authorized charges and potential settlements.

Inaccurate or late payroll filings can incur penalties. Employers should file numerous payroll types and studies with federal and state companies. Submitting these types late or with incorrect info can lead to penalties. For instance, late submitting of quarterly wage studies or annual reconciliation types can set off fines, and inaccurate filings might require corrections, resulting in further administrative work and prices.

Misclassifying staff as contractors can lead to again taxes and fines. Correctly classifying employees as staff or impartial contractors is necessary for tax functions. Misclassification can result in unpaid payroll taxes, as contractors are accountable for their very own taxes, whereas employers should withhold and pay taxes for workers. If an audit reveals misclassification, you could owe again taxes, curiosity, and penalties. Moreover, you might face authorized motion from misclassified employees searching for worker advantages and protections.

Understanding these penalties helps you preserve compliance with New Mexico payroll laws and keep away from expensive errors. Correct payroll administration ensures your online business operates easily and legally.
